  • Abstract
    MIMO radar in this paper uses sparse-array to transmit the FMCW signals of multiple carrier frequencies, and an array to receive the echoes. Due to transmit signals of multiple carrier frequencies, the Doppler frequency of the received signals after separated is not in a Doppler cell, and then the traditional supper-resolution algorithms work ineffectively, the parameters of the target can´t be obtained. One method is presented in this paper. Firstly the data of different frequency is transformed into the data of the same frequency using focusing transformation, and then the spatial spectrum estimation algorithms are applied. The simulation results indicate the validity of the methods presented in this paper.
